This evening I helped deliver food, that would have been thrown away from a busy village shop, to people who could made good use of It.

These days shops and supermarkets encourage community groups to take and distribute unsold food.

Having “saved” food delivered to people’s homes has advantages for people who can’t leave their homes for health reasons, or some might feel there is a stigma with taking free food.
